Heckmondwike is a town and electoral ward in the metropolitan district of Kirklees, West Yorkshire, in England. It is located 9 miles south west of Leeds. Historically a part of the West Riding of Yorkshire, it is also close to Cleckheaton and Liversedge. Situated at the edge of the Pennine hills, the land climbs to the north, east and south of the town centre. In total, the area covered by the town is 1 square mile. In accordance with the 2011 Census, the town has a permanent population of around 16986, which has decreased a little from the 17066 documented in the 2001 Census. The records of the Poll Tax of 1379 usefully details that there was a total of 7 families residing in Heckmondwike, which amounted to 35 people. The majority resided in isolated farmsteads, such as Stubley Farm, where they would be on high ground looking out on the marshy Spen Valley floor. By 1684, it is estimated that there were around 250 people in the town, with the existence of around 50 dwellings. Throughout the course of the 19th century, the town built a reputation for the manufacture of blankets. By 1811, the Blanket Hall was completed to enhance business in the town’s most important manufacture. It was replaced by another hall in 1839 on Blanket Hall Street, although the remains of the first hall remained in the town till the spring of 2008 when a number of old buildings were destroyed. The remains of the Power Company buildings, nevertheless, continue to exist in the town, in spite of the fact that the town stopped producing electricity in 1924.
